Key Buying Factors for Particle Counters
Particle Size Channels
More channels can provide a clearer picture of contamination, but only if the size bands match your application. Cleanroom buyers usually need finer granularity, while general air-quality users may only need common PM fractions like PM0.3, PM2.5, and PM10.
Sampling Method and Flow
Stable suction and consistent sampling improve measurement reliability. If you are comparing Particle Counters for professional inspection, check whether the device uses a pump, how it samples air, and whether the flow rate is specified.
Accuracy and Certification
Look for ISO-relevant certification or calibration support when measurements need to stand up to compliance or quality-control work. For less formal monitoring, accuracy still matters, but portability and ease of use may carry more weight.
Environmental Sensors and Reporting
Temperature, humidity, dew point, and gas readings can help explain why particle levels change. Data logging, USB transfer, and clear displays are especially valuable if you need to document trends over time.
